Course 1 (Duration 1 day)
How to Save Time on P.E Administration and Planning in all Areas
of Primary P.E.
This is a one day course for P.E. Co-ordinators and School Sports Co-ordinators who wish to revise and standardise practice and policy in their school clusters for Key Stage 1 and / or Key Stage 2. It is also suitable for reviewing planning, assessing, recording, reporting, policy writing and Minimum Expected Standards throughout the P.E. curriculum.
The Course Contents:
Reviewing PE Policies and Procedures
- Outlining the policies that should be in place.
- Detailed discussion of their content.
- Specific examples of good practice.
Planning and Organising the PE Curriculum
- Long term planning – time entitlement and breadth and
balance.
- Medium term planning – unit framework, learning objectives
and expected learning outcomes.
- Short term planning.
Health and Safety Issues
- Opportunities to bring your Health and Safety procedures and
policies up to date.
- Addressing a range of issues including handling
apparatus, jewellery,
PE kit and risk assessment.
Simple and Manageable Assessment
- What do we assess, when and how
- Looking at simple systems for
recording pupil performance in physical education
The course guides participants through the issues
overleaf involved in the management and administration of the P.E.
curriculum and
enables the setting and maintaining of high standards. Course
members will receive advice and have opportunities to discuss
a range of
related topics. As part of the course all members
will receive a personal copy of the very comprehensive PEAPS
manual of
planning resources for P.E. (Click
to view manual)
